Andrew, who’s almost 4 years old, had a near drowning.  As you can imagine this is any family's worst nightmare; yet we believe in an almighty God. Please pray for kidney function and brain activity to fully restore.

On Friday, Oct 11, Andrew came down with a fever and threw up. He was in the bathtub soaking in 6 inches of water and epsom salt; just 15 feet from the kitchen and living room. He was found unconscious--which is baffling as he's the strongest child of his 5 siblings at that age and an amazing swimmer, even in the open ocean. Chest compression began, he had a slight heartbeat. He spent a few hours at Wilcox hospital before medical evacuation to Oahu.

Currently the whole family is on Oahu at Kapi’olani children’s hospital where Andrew is on life support in the PICU Unit receiving emergency care. The doctors have been amazing, and have made every change to his health care that we've asked for based on drowning research.

We are reaching out to families that have been there before us and we have incredible support from this team. One of the biggest reports we have heard about is HBOT (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y) and protocols from Dr. Paul Harch.  We want to take Andrew to see Dr. Harch in New Orleans as soon as possible. But in the meantime, Dr. Harch has spoken to Andrew's  doctor here at Kapi'olani.  We are also hearing about many other alternative and traditional treatments, all of which will be big endeavors.
